RED STAR CRICKET CLUB
ANNUAL MEETING OF MEMBERS. THREE TEAMS FOR COMPETITIONS The annual meeting of the Red Star Cricket Club was held last night. The annual report and balance-sheet were adopted. The election of officers resulted as follows: —Patron, Mr C. Perry; president, Mr L. J. Matthews; vice-presid-ents, Messrs B. Iveson, W. Fly, E. Hayden, H. B. Thomas, P. Prescott, F. Miller, E. Buckton; club captain, Mr E. F. Pool; management committee, Messrs J. Renner, W. Peterson, D. Wellington, E. F. Pool, C. Roys; secretary, Mr G. B. Peterson; treasurer, Mr B. Wilmshurst; auditor, Mr W. B. Yates; delegates to the Wairarapa Cricket Association, Messrs W. Peterson, F. Hoar, D. Wellington, B. Wilmshurst; selection committee, Messrs F. Hoar and W. Peterson. ' The members stood in silence as a mark of respect to the memory of the late Mr E. Welch. It was decided to enter a senior and two junior teams in the Wairarapa Cricket Association’s competition.
